.section-testimonials-slider{position:relative}.section-testimonials-slider__inner{display:flex;flex-direction:column;grid-template-columns:1fr;gap:20px}.section-testimonials-slider__header{text-align:center}.section-testimonials-slider__rating{display:flex;flex-direction:row;align-items:center;justify-content:center;gap:10px;margin-bottom:20px}.section-rating__stars{display:flex;gap:4px;align-items:center}.section-rating__stars svg{width:24px;height:24px;color:gold}.section-rating__text{font-size:16px;color:rgba(var(--color-foreground),1);text-transform:uppercase;letter-spacing:-.01em;line-height:1.35}.section-testimonials-slider .page-width{position:relative;padding-left:0;padding-right:0}.section-testimonials-slider__heading{text-align:center;margin-bottom:20px;max-width:350px;margin-left:auto;margin-right:auto}.section-testimonials-slider__heading .h2{margin:0;font-size:44px;line-height:1.1;letter-spacing:-.01em}.section-testimonials-slider__description{text-align:center;margin-bottom:40px;font-size:16px}.section-testimonials-slider__container:not(.slick-initialized){opacity:0}.testimonial-slide-item{display:flex;flex-direction:column;justify-content:flex-end;height:100%;width:100%;gap:8px}.testimonial-slide-item__title-link{text-decoration:none;margin:0;text-transform:uppercase;font-family:var(--font-body-family);color:rgba(var(--color-foreground));display:block;flex-shrink:0}.testimonial-slide-item__title{font-size:18px;font-weight:700;color:inherit;margin:0;line-height:1.4;transition:color .2s ease;display:flex!important;align-items:flex-end}.testimonial{position:relative;background:#fff;border-radius:20px;padding:28px 24px 24px;width:100%;display:flex;flex-direction:column;background-color:var(--junipPrimaryColor);color:var(--junipButtonTextColor);aspect-ratio:332/612;flex:0 0 auto}.testimonial__title{font-size:clamp(28px,calc(1.6893rem + .2589vw),32px);font-weight:600;margin:0 0 8px;color:inherit;line-height:1.2;min-height:80px;font-weight:500;letter-spacing:-.02em;vertical-align:middle;display:flex;align-items:center}.testimonial__rating{display:flex;gap:1px;margin-top:30px;margin-bottom:6px;align-items:center}.testimonial__rating svg{width:22px;height:22px;color:gold}.testimonial .button{margin-top:auto;max-width:244px;width:100%;margin-left:auto;margin-right:auto}.testimonial__text{font-size:clamp(16px,calc(.9393rem + .2589vw),20px);line-height:1.4;font-style:normal;margin:0;color:inherit;border:none;padding:0}.testimonial__author{font-size:16px;font-style:normal;min-height:50px;flex-shrink:0;display:block!important}.testimonial__author strong{font-style:normal;display:block;font-size:16px;line-height:1;margin-bottom:0}.testimonial__author span{text-transform:uppercase;font-size:12px;letter-spacing:.33px;line-height:1.2;font-weight:400}.testimonial-video{position:relative;width:100%;border-radius:20px;overflow:hidden;background-color:#000;flex:0 0 auto;aspect-ratio:332/612}.testimonial-video--shopify{cursor:pointer}.testimonial-video--image{background-color:transparent}.testimonial-image__img{width:100%;height:100%;object-fit:cover;display:block}.testimonial-video__poster{position:absolute;top:0;left:0;width:100%;height:100%;z-index:1;display:block}.testimonial-video__poster-img{width:100%;height:100%;object-fit:cover}.testimonial-video .button{position:absolute;z-index:1;bottom:0;left:0;right:0;width:100%;max-width:244px;margin:0 auto 24px}.testimonial-video video{width:100%;height:100%;object-fit:cover;position:relative;z-index:1}.testimonial-video__overlay{position:absolute;top:0;left:0;right:0;bottom:0;z-index:10;pointer-events:none;-webkit-transform:translateZ(0);transform:translateZ(0)}.play-button{position:absolute;top:50%;left:50%;pointer-events:auto;-webkit-transform:translate(-50%,-50%) translateZ(0);transform:translate(-50%,-50%) translateZ(0);transform:translate(-50%,-50%);border:none;border-radius:50%;display:flex;align-items:center;justify-content:center;cursor:pointer;transition:all .3s ease;z-index:5;background-color:transparent;padding:10px}.play-button:hover{-webkit-transform:translate(-50%,-50%) translateZ(0) scale(1.1);transform:translate(-50%,-50%) translateZ(0) scale(1.1)}.play-button svg{width:48px;height:48px;color:#fff;filter:drop-shadow(0px 0px 20px rgba(0,0,0,.5))}.mute-button{position:absolute;top:20px;right:20px;background-color:#00000026;border:none;border-radius:50%;width:32px;height:32px;display:none;align-items:center;justify-content:center;cursor:pointer;transition:all .3s ease;z-index:20;pointer-events:auto;-webkit-transform:translateZ(0);transform:translateZ(0)}.mute-button.is-playing{display:flex}.mute-button span{height:16px;width:16px}.mute-button svg{width:16px;height:16px;color:#fff;filter:drop-shadow(0px 0px 4px rgba(0,0,0,.1))}.section-testimonials-slider__container .slick-slide{padding:0 10px}.section-testimonials-slider .slick-track{display:flex;align-items:stretch}.section-testimonials-slider .slick-initialized .slick-slide{display:flex;height:auto}.section-testimonials-slider__container .slick-dots{display:flex;justify-content:center;margin:24px 0 0;padding:0;list-style-type:none}.section-testimonials-slider__container .slick-dots li{margin:0 .65rem}.section-testimonials-slider__container .slick-dots button{display:block;width:1rem;height:1rem;padding:0;border-radius:100%;text-indent:-9999px;border:1px solid #078be2;background-color:#f5f8ff;cursor:pointer}.section-testimonials-slider__container .slick-dots li.slick-active button{background-color:#078be2}.section-testimonials-slider__prev,.section-testimonials-slider__next{position:absolute;top:50%;transform:translateY(-50%);z-index:10;cursor:pointer;display:flex!important;align-items:center;justify-content:center;background:#ffffffe6;border:none;border-radius:50%;width:44px;height:44px;transition:all .3s ease;box-shadow:0 2px 8px #00000026}.section-testimonials-slider__prev{left:-22px}.section-testimonials-slider__next{right:-22px}.section-testimonials-slider__prev:hover,.section-testimonials-slider__next:hover{background:#fff;box-shadow:0 4px 12px #0003}.section-testimonials-slider__prev.slick-disabled,.section-testimonials-slider__next.slick-disabled{opacity:.3;cursor:not-allowed}.section-testimonials-slider__prev svg,.section-testimonials-slider__next svg{width:28px;height:27px}@media only screen and (min-width: 1200px){.section-testimonials-slider__container{grid-column:span 3}.section-testimonials-slider__header{grid-column:span 1}.section-testimonials-slider .page-width{padding-left:20px;padding-right:20px}.section-testimonials-slider__inner{display:grid;gap:0;grid-template-columns:repeat(4,1fr)}.section-testimonials-slider__header{text-align:left}.section-testimonials-slider__rating{justify-content:flex-start;margin-bottom:24px;margin-top:46px}.section-rating__stars svg{width:22px;height:22px}.section-rating__text{font-size:20px;line-height:1.4}.section-testimonials-slider__heading{text-align:left}.section-testimonials-slider__heading .h2{font-size:48px;margin:0}.section-testimonials-slider__description{font-size:18px;margin-bottom:60px}.testimonial,.testimonial-video{min-height:612px}.testimonial__author{font-size:16px;font-style:normal;min-height:50px}.testimonial__author strong{font-style:normal;display:block;font-size:20px;line-height:1;margin-bottom:4px}.testimonial__author span{text-transform:uppercase;font-size:18px;letter-spacing:.33px;line-height:1.2;font-weight:400}}
/*# sourceMappingURL=/cdn/shop/t/89/assets/section-testimonials-slider.css.map */
